Chair Sit-and-Reach: Females, Age 80-84

What these numbers mean

A value around 0.5 inches is typical (50th percentile) for females in this age group. Scores above about 3.0 inches fall near the 75th percentile or higher, indicating above-average performance. Scores below about -2.0 inches fall near the 25th percentile; about 75% of the reference population scored higher.

Data source: Rikli & Jones (SFT) (1999) · n=7.2K About this study

Chair Sit-and-Reach Percentile Chart (inches)

Poor -5.0 inches
Below average -2.0 inches
Average 0.5 inches
Above average 3.0 inches
Excellent 6.6 inches

This percentile chart shows how common a value is, not whether it is healthy.

Senior Fitness Test Battery

This metric is part of the Senior Fitness Test, a validated 7-test battery for adults aged 60-94.
